hi, just come back from my local beach it works fine in the dry sand, it does pick up the iron cored coins like the 1 and 2ps (broken signal though) and now that the 5s and 10s are going the same way it will get them too as my explorer se doesn't, I wanted to find out what it was like in wet sand which is mainly why I went out, I did find 5 coins in the wet not very deep about 5" or so but I did notice the signals are not as strong as the explorer but they are there you just have to listen as the deeper they are the weaker they were, I hope this helps.

I have done different beaches with the Deus every day this week, some dry sand, some wet sand and even shale on top of wet and dry sand. I found the dry beach setting better on dry and damp sand then switching to the wet beach setting for very wet areas that have only just been left behind by the retreating tide.
I am still learning to differentiate between bottle tops and ring pulls compared to coins but by digging everything to confirm my assessment, even after such a short time I can get it right 80% of the time. This also showed the Deus is picking out signals 8 to 10 inches down, obviously the deeper the item the quieter and more broken the signal.
I have also become skilled at finding and ignoring mineralised rocks and carbonised beach fire pits
